Black History Month at NHS

Every February, people across Canada participate in Black History Month events and festivities that honour the legacy of Black people in Canada and their communities. NHS honours this important commemorative month in many ways. In addition to classroom activities, research projects and artwork, you’ll see posters throughout our hallways! Students can engage with these posters by casually reading them or by finding the answers to the corresponding crossword puzzle created by some of our grade 9 students!
